Circle Packing in Circle 这篇文章学习总结了两篇关于圆形容器内的圆填充问题的经典论文。 1.问题描述 CirclePacking in Circle问题可表示为能否以及如何将n个具有各自大小的圆形无覆盖五越界的包装在一个大的圆形容器中。 这是一个NP-Hard问题,前人的一些工作可以找到和最优解精度非常相似的一个解,不过非常耗时,...
当然,这里的Ball Packing和Incircle Packing是互逆的:显然任何Incircle和正交球的集合都能产生CP Mesh,每个球对应了一个网格顶点,内切圆对应了网格面,这样就形成了一种对偶(Dual)关系。当我们用这个Incircle-Ball的集合来表示CP Mesh时,它就可以变成一个莫比乌斯几何体(Mobius Geometry)的对象:莫比乌斯变换(Mobius t...
circle packing定理 Circle Packing定理指的是:一个图是一个圆堆的相切图,当且仅当该图是平面图。也就是说,如果能在纸上用不相交的曲线画出一个图,那么一定也可以用直线来画,并且可以调整直线的长度,使得每个顶点上都可以放个圆盘,圆盘之间在且仅在直线上相切。如果一个图是平面的三角化,那么不计反演变换,该...
已经开发了大量确定性和随机性的圆填充算法(点击文末“阅读原文”获取完整代码数据)。 圆填充Circle packing算法 RepelLayout通过成对排斥迭代移动圆圈来搜索非重叠布局。圆的位置被限制在一个矩形区域内。为避免边缘效应,可以将边界区域视为环面,例如,推到左侧边缘的圆将重新进入右侧边缘的边界区域。这是一种非常简单...
对一个 circle packing,比较重要的组合对象是其相切图。每个圆盘是一个顶点,两个圆盘相切就在相应顶点...
圆堆图,英文circle packing,在数据可视化领域,将不同的圆堆积在一个大圆中,用于展示圆之间的大小关系。相对于treemap,圆堆图更直观简洁,虽然利用率上有缺陷。 D3.js中给出了一个circle packing的demo,但在p…
圆填充Circle packing算法 已经开发了大量确定性和随机性的圆填充算法。 RepelLayout通过成对排斥迭代移动圆圈来搜索非重叠布局。圆的位置被限制在一个矩形区域内。为避免边缘效应,可以将边界区域视为环面,例如,推到左侧边缘的圆将重新进入右侧边缘的边界区域。这是一种非常简单且效率相当低的算法,但通常会产生良好的结...
(5)圆形装填(Circle Packing), 通过圆圈的大小和归属表达明确的层级关系。(6)节点树(Node-Link Trees)。 www.civn.cn|基于9个网页 2. 圆填充 最近,对拱共形映射、圆填充(circle packing)理论及相关领域进行了深入的研究,取得较好的成果。已有几篇研究论文… ...
作为共形映射的离散模拟的圆填充理论在复分析和离散几何的交叉学科中是一个快速发展的研究领域。 Afterthen, much research on circle packings and their applications followed.
循环包装,指的是用可以重复利用的包装材料包装的。比如纸箱就是这类的。